No Amends Setbacks for Poultry Barns and Associated Enclosed Manure Storage (R98-61) Moved by Councillor Gill, seconded by Councillor Wiebe, that By-law No , cited as "Abbotsford Zoning By-law, 1996, AmendmentBy-IawNo. 136", now be read a second and third time. Moved by Councillor Fast, seconded by Councillor Ross, that By-law No , cited as "Abbotsford Zoning By-law, 1996, Amendment By-law No. 136", be amended to reduce the setbacks for poultry barns and associated manure storage to 15 m, rather than 20 m. In support of the proposed amendment, reference was made to correspondence received at the August 17, 1998, Public Hearing, in which six groups involved in the "feather" industry had indicated support of reducing poultry barn setbacks to 15 m, similar to surrounding municipalities. It was noted that an increase to the minimum quotas necessitated larger operations and that technological enhancements had improved the handling of waste. One member of Council commented that the Agricultural Select Committee had made the recommendation for a 20 m setback without seeking input from the affected industry, and there was a suggestion that the 15 m setback would assist Abbotsford's agricultural industry remain competitive.
5 the Matsqui Centennial Auditorium Page 5 Speaking in opposition to the proposed amendment, several Council members contended that recommendations of the Agricultural Select Committee should be endorsed, and one member commented on the "industrialization"offarming, expressing concern about intensive farming operations on small parcels ofland. It was noted that amending the by-law would necessitate a new public hearing. The amendment motion was then put and ~ / DEFEATED. Opposed: Councillors Gill, Peary, *R~~, ~arawa, and Wiebe *as amended by Resolution No. R576-98/ The original motion was then put and R CARRlED..4 By-law No ,Z.A.
